Could the Goddess be lying in wait for Asuka, in a few hours?
This week, we saw vignettes proclaiming that Asuka was on her way to the main roster! One woman who did not seem too enthused by this news was Raw Women's Champion, the gorgeous Alexa Bliss. One guesses that Asuka would be in attendance for a match of this magnitude. Especially when it features a fellow Japanese megastar in Kairi!

Could WWE sow the seeds for a program between the two women, by having Bliss attack Asuka while she's in attendance at the event? This would certainly cause quite a stir and gain babyface sympathy for the 'Empress of Tomorrow' before she comes to the main roster. This is because she's supposed to be injured, right now.
